Escalante, Utah
Named after Fray Silvestre Velez de Escalante, a Spanish
priest who accompanied
Fray Francisco Atanasia Dominguez, the leader of the
Dominguez -Escalante expedition that came
through southwestern Utah in 1776, searching for a passable
trail to Los Angeles, California.
